Loan Origination Fee & Calculation
- A 4.228% origination fee is deducted from each loan disbursement.
- To calculate the loan amount you should request, divide the amount you need by 0.95764.
- Example: If you need $8,000 to cover expenses, request $8,354 ($8,000 ÷ 0.95764).
Requesting a Graduate PLUS Loan Increase
If your existing Graduate PLUS Loan did not require an endorser, you can request an increase directly through Fordham.
If your existing Graduate PLUS Loan required an endorser, you must submit a new application through the Department of Education.
